Regimental number | 1089 |
Place of birth | Nottingham, England |
School | Higher Grade School, Nottingham, England |
Age on arrival in Australia | 25 |
Religion | Baptist |
Occupation | Fitter |
Address | 173 Trent Boullard, West Bridgford, Nottingham, England |
Marital status | Single |
Age at embarkation | 27 |
Next of kin | Mother, Mrs A C Scanlon, 173 Trent Boullard, West Bridgford, Nottingham, England |
Enlistment date | |
Date of enlistment from Nominal Roll | |
Rank on enlistment | Private |
Unit name | 22nd Battalion, C Company |
AWM Embarkation Roll number | 23/39/1 |
Embarkation details | Unit embarked from Melbourne, Victoria, on board HMAT A38 Ulysses on |
Regimental number from Nominal Roll | Commissioned |
Rank from Nominal Roll | 2nd Lieutenant |
Unit from Nominal Roll | 22nd Battalion |
Fate | Killed in Action |
Place of death or wounding | Pozieres, Somme Sector, France |
Age at death | 29 |
Age at death from cemetery records | 29 |
Place of burial | Pozieres British Cemetery (Plot III, Row E, Grave No. 10), Ovillers-La-Boisselle, France |
Panel number, Roll of Honour, Australian War Memorial | 97 |
Miscellaneous information from cemetery records | Parents: William and Annie SCANLON, 3 Mapperley Crescent, Woodborough Road, Nottingham, England |
